What are the responsibilities of a manager dispensary store?

A Manager Dispensary Store oversees the daily operations of a dispensary, ensuring compliance with all local and state regulations, managing staff, and providing excellent customer service. They are responsible for inventory management, staff scheduling, financial reporting, and maintaining a safe and welcoming environment for customers. Additionally, they often handle employee training, resolve customer issues, and implement marketing strategies to drive sales and growth.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a manager dispensary store?

To thrive as a Manager Dispensary Store, you need experience in retail management, knowledge of cannabis regulations, and typically a high school diploma or higher.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, inventory management software, and compliance tracking tools is crucial. Exceptional leadership, customer service, and problem-solving skills help you effectively lead staff and ensure a positive customer experience. These competencies are vital for maintaining legal compliance, operational efficiency, and the store's reputation in a regulated industry.

What are some common challenges faced by a manager dispensary store, and how can they be effectively addressed?

A Manager Dispensary Store often faces challenges such as maintaining regulatory compliance, managing inventory efficiently, and ensuring exceptional customer service. Staying updated on local and state cannabis laws is crucial to avoid legal issues. Additionally, managing a diverse team and resolving conflicts in a fast-paced retail environment requires strong leadership and communication skills. Developing standard operating procedures and investing in staff training can help address these challenges and create a successful, compliant, and customer-focused dispensary.

STORE GENERAL MANAGER
This role reports to the District/Operations Manager. The General Manager (GM) is responsible for the successful daily operation of the dispensary and developing a professional team that is passionate about the cannabis industry.
The GM is also responsible for overseeing daily operations, store specific marketing & promotions and working with other administrative departments to maintain accurate compliance, procedures and reports as they pertain to the daily operations and financials of the dispensary.
Roles and Responsibilities
Staff Management
  • Fulfill staffing needs and coordinate scheduling, following payroll budget guidelines.
  • Communicate with and coach staff regularly to ensure the dispensary's excellence in service and labor practices.
  • Conduct ongoing training and development with staff to ensure consistent performance and knowledge base of Company SOPs, policies, procedures, evolving product and consumption mechanisms & customer service skills.  
  • Manage employees’ performance through observation, providing constructive feedback, coaching and disciplinary conversations and offering positive reinforcement. Conduct periodic employee reviews.
  • Assist staff in challenging patient/customer interactions and/or conflict resolutions quickly, professionally and with least impact on operations. When possible, coach staff on deescalation techniques and customer services approaches.   When necessary, document incidents via internal procedures.

Inventory Management
  • Oversee movement of product to ensure product mix meets customer needs and replenished appropriately and within budgetary constraints.
  • Maintain inventory control systems, oversee scheduled inventory audits in accordance with Company and State compliance guidelines to ensure there is no diversion of inventory and effectively respond to discrepancies.

Administrative/Operations
  • Work closely with administration to ensure the dispensary is compliant with all Company & State guidelines.
  • Oversee operations and establish standards for set up, break down, cleaning schedules and other daily tasks
  • Read, analyze, and interpret documents relating to dispensary performance, general business operations, industry trends, basic safety, security and technical procedures and governmental regulations.
  • Confirm that the physical environment is safe, and that all equipment/software is in good working order and ensure that all preventative maintenance is performed in a timely manner.
  • Prepare and effectively lead state inspectors through unannounced visits.
  • Set in-store sales, service, and profit goals and lead staff to exceed them.
  • Communicate effectively and in a timely manner with Administration.
  • Maintain accurate records for all necessary documents; including but not limited to: daily cash reconciliations, delivery and inventory manifests, nightly and monthly inventory counts, necessary employee and patient/customer information, required log books, inventory adjustments and destruction reports, in accordance with Company and State guidelines.
  • Work with Administration to create and follow in-store budgets and forecast sales.  
  • Utilize available marketing to help reach certain sales goals. Think “outside of the box” to reach store goals.
  • Complete special assignments and other tasks, as assigned.

Work Experience
  • Previous experience in a cannabis retail/customer service role required, including cannabis product knowledge, cannabis POS experience, but particularly metrc experience needed.
  • Some supervisory or leadership experience is necessary.   
  • Strong communication skills, both written and oral, and strong interpersonal skills. 
  • Strong cash handling skills and knowledge of basic arithmetic. 
  • Bilingual English/Spanish preferred but not required.
  • Strong customer Service skills.
  • Basic Microsoft office experience including Word and Excel.

What You Should Bring:
  • Current MED badge required
  • Valid ID, 21 and over only.
  • High school diploma or equivalent preferred.
  • Fun attitude and work ethic.
  • Strong attention to detail and a team-player attitude is a must.
  • Sense of responsibility to abide by all company policies and procedures as well as compliance with all local, state and federal regulations
  • An eye for style, maintaining a neat and well-groomed appearance, as well as good personal hygiene. Ensure that all clothing follows the company dress code.
  • The ability to creatively cultivate long-term customer relationships.

Working Conditions 
  • Ability to stand for extended periods of time and lift up to 50lbs multiple times per day.
  • Schedule will vary depending on the needs of the business and can include nights, Weekends, and Holidays.
  • Ability to perform the following physical tasks: sitting, standing, stooping, stretching, walking, bending, twisting, reaching, performing repetitive motions, and carrying boxes. Must be able to sit, stand, reach, and lift for long periods of time
